Eugene A. Verkamp, 69 of Ferdinand passed away at his home Tuesday November 3rd 2015. He was born July 28, 1946 in Ferdinand to Albert & Augusta (Krampe) Verkamp. He married Phyllis Schlachter on May 24, 1986 on the family farm.

Surviving are his wife, Phyllis Verkamp, two sons, Neil Verkamp, & John Fleig and his wife Rebecca both of Ferdinand.Two daughters, Becky Seng and husband Steve of Dubois and Elizabeth “Ebby” Weyer and husband Nick of Ferdinand. Six grandchildren Xander & Brooklyn Fleig, Kennedy & Addison Weyer, Austin & Shyann Seng.two brothers, Joseph Verkamp of Jasper, Dennis Verkamp and wife Camille of Moorsville, four sisters, Mary Ann Verkamp and husband Paul Brown of Indianapolis, Carol Burger and husband Ted of Fairland, In., Ruth Wibbels and husband John of Jasper, & Rachel Hurm and husband Roger of Rockport. He was preceded in death by his parents and his step-mother Lauretta Verkamp.

Gene was a retired carpenter and superintendent at Seufert Construction Company. He was a member of St. Ferdinand Parish and its St. Joseph’s Sodality. He was a lifetime member of The Ferdinand Community Center, and the St. Anthony Conservation Club. He coached 5th & 6th grade girls basketball at Ferdinand Elementary for 15 years. He was Owner/Operator of Beagles & Bunnies and trained beagles for many years. His hobbies include fishing, hunting, making wine, and spending time with his grandchildren. He was a true outdoorsman.

Funeral services 10:00 AM Saturday November 7th in Saint Henry Catholic Church, St. Henry, burial to follow in Saint Ferdinand Church Cemetery, Ferdinand. Friends may call from 2 to 8:00 PM Friday & 7 to 9:30 AM Saturday at Becher Funeral Home, Ferdinand. Memorial contributions may be made to St. Ferdinand Church Renew.
